                                    //In Laravel we use throttle middleware to restrict the amount of traffic 
//for a given route or group of routes. The throttle middleware accepts two parameters 
//that determine the maximum number of requests that can be made in a given number of minutes. 
//For example: 
//Here 60 is number of requests you can make in 1 minute.
  
Route::middleware('throttle:60,1')->get('/user', function () { 
  //
});
